Built on six core values—Family, Honor, Respect, Attitude, Discipline, and Loyalty—Six Blades Jiu-Jitsu Pacific Beach is a martial arts academy at 969 Garnet Ave in the 92109. Professor Gustavo Dias, a world-champion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u competitor, founded the academy in early 2023 alongside business partner Joshua Zdunich, and operations manager Mehgan True oversees daily scheduling. Dias trains in the lineage of Saulo and Xande Ribeiro, and he was profiled by SDVoyager for his commitment to building a family-oriented dojo rooted in traditional martial arts values. Students currently range from age three to sixty-nine, and the structured curriculum includes youth leadership assignments designed to build confidence, manners, and decision-making skills.
